

Super Battletank 2 is one of those SNES games that doesn’t mess around—you’re thrown straight into a warzone with a tank that feels like it weighs a ton (in a good way). The controls take a second to get used to—turning the turret while moving is clunky at first, but once it clicks, blasting through enemy bases feels satisfying. It’s got that classic 90s vibe where explosions shake the screen and the music kicks in at just the right moments.
This is technically the third game in the series, but don’t worry if you haven’t played the others. You’re just here to drive a massive tank, blow stuff up, and maybe curse a little when an ambush catches you off guard. The Spain version doesn’t change much, but it’s cool to have if you’re into regional oddities. Definitely one for fans of slow-but-heavy arcade-style action.
